Portable
USBDeview is a small utility that does not require installation, making it easy to use across different systems without setup.
Detailed Information
Provides comprehensive details about USB devices connected to a computer, including their description, serial number, and when they were added.
Supports Remote Access
Allows users to view USB device information from a remote computer, enhancing its utility in networked environments.
Device Management
Enables users to disable and enable USB devices, offering better control over the connected devices.
Export Options
Users can export USB device information to different file formats such as text, CSV, HTML, or XML for easy documentation.
